Hardware Specifications and Performance

The Vector 16 packs serious gaming firepower with its 140W RTX 5070 Ti mobile GPU, which sits in the upper tier of Nvidia's current laptop graphics lineup. This particular configuration pairs the GPU with Intel's Core Ultra 7 255HX processor, a 20-core chip designed for high-performance mobile computing.

The laptop features a 16-inch 240Hz display with a 16:10 aspect ratio, providing slightly more vertical screen real estate than traditional 16:9 panels. While the resolution sits just above 1080p, the high refresh rate ensures smooth gameplay for competitive titles.

Memory and storage configurations include 16GB of DDR5 RAM and a 512GB SSD, both of which offer upgrade paths through secondary slots. This expandability is particularly valuable given the increasing storage requirements of modern games and applications.

Battery Life and Build Quality

MSI equipped the Vector 16 with a 90Wh battery, which should provide all-day battery life for moderate tasks like web browsing and document editing. However, gaming laptops typically see significantly reduced battery life under load.

The chassis uses a plastic construction with aggressive cooling fans. While this might seem dated compared to premium metal builds, the design likely contributes to better sustained performance by allowing more effective heat dissipation during extended gaming sessions.

Connectivity and Features

Wireless connectivity includes Wi-Fi 7 and Bluetooth 5.4, ensuring compatibility with the latest networking standards. The port selection covers essential needs with multiple USB ports, HDMI output, Ethernet, a headphone jack, and an onboard SD card reader.

The keyboard features 24-zone RGB backlighting and includes a dedicated Copilot key for Microsoft's AI assistant. This positions the laptop as ready for both gaming and productivity workloads.
